Navigating Disagreements with Your Insurance Company
When disputes arise with your insurance provider, clear and concise communication is paramount. Begin by carefully here reviewing your policy documents to understand your coverage and any relevant exclusions. Log all interactions with the insurance company, including dates, times, names of representatives, and summary. When contacting the provider, remain composed and respectful. Articulate your concerns in a structured manner, providing supporting evidence if available. Be persistent in advocating a fair resolution. If you experience difficulty addressing the issue directly with the provider, consider escalating your case to their customer service department or an independent insurance ombudsman.
Typical Insurance Claim Pitfalls and How to Avoid Them
Filing an insurance claim can be a complicated process, and navigating it successfully requires careful attention to detail. There are several common pitfalls that claimants often fall into, which can lead to delays or even denials. To ensure a smooth claims process, it's essential to recognize these potential problems and take steps to avoid them.
One frequent mistake is presenting an incomplete application. Be sure to provide all the necessary information and documentation, as missing details can lead to your claim being put on hold. It's also crucial to report your insurer about any changes to your circumstances promptly. Failure to do so could void your coverage and leave you unprotected in case of a future occurrence.
Another common pitfall is overstating the extent of your losses. While it's understandable to want to receive full compensation, being dishonest about damages can cause serious problems. Your insurer has ways to confirm claims, and any discrepancies will likely lead to a denied claim or even legal action.
Remember, honesty and openness are key when dealing with insurance claims. By avoiding these common pitfalls and following best practices, you can increase your chances of a successful outcome.
